Homeowners over the age of 62 who have more equity in their home than debt can qualify for a Michigan reverse mortgage, which provides the cash they need in their golden years.
Michigan reverse mortgage refinancing might be right for you if you want to stay in your home, but still want the extra financial cushion for medical bills, home expenses and other expenses. Michigan reverse mortgage programs supply cash as a lump sum, monthly payments, a line of credit, or some combination of those. Homeowners can count on having the cash they need while they stay in their home with a reverse mortgage. Michigan homeowners can relax knowing that their financial needs will be taken care of with a reverse mortgage.
The best candidates for a Michigan reverse mortgage and line of credit are homeowners who have completely paid off their homes or have a very small first mortgage. Since the reverse mortgage is paid off when the owners leave the home, though, this is not always a good lending option for people who plan to leave their home to heirs.
